Body
Founding
Sharp Corporation's founder is recorded as Tokuji Hayakawa[10]. Recorded inception include 1912[24] and 2013-01-13[25]. Its location of formation is recorded as Tokyo[26].
Operations
Sharp Corporation's headquarters location is recorded as Osaka[18]. Its parent organization or unit is recorded as Foxconn[27]. Its child organization or unit is recorded as Sharp Solar[19].
Industry
Sharp Corporation's industry is recorded as electronics[23].
Ownership
Owners include Foxconn Group[11], a business[28], founded in 1974[29]; Foxconn (Far East)[12]; Foxconn Technology[13]; CTBC Bank[14], a commercial bank[30], in Taiwan[31], founded in 1966[32], headquartered in Taipei[33]; SIO International Holdings[15]; and Nippon Life Insurance Company[16], a mutual insurance[34], in Japan[35], founded in 1889[36], headquartered in Chūō-ku[37]. Stock exchanges include OTC Markets Group[21] and Tokyo Stock Exchange[22]. Sharp Corporation's product or material produced is recorded as home appliance[38].
